It was a gathering with heart, as high society came together at a charity art event to help the visually impaired.
Hosted by Sangeeta Assomull, her sons Vikram and Gaurav and Chhaya Momaya, “It was about learning to share with gratitude and dignity,” according to Chhaya. The venue sported a black decor and to  recitations of Vande Mataram and We Are The World, guests lit candles on their tables to honour the children’s struggles. Mahesh Jethmalani announced the lucky draws while wife Haseena was happy to be among the art and   musical notes. Suresh Oberoi came with wife Vasundara and daughter Megha, the latter who seemed quite taken up with the evening. Shailendra Singh seemed jovial and friendly, Anju Chulani was with son Zal,  while Kajal Fabiani in stylish blue, bonded with Anju’s mom Durga Chulani.
